From e2a9357f18c10bb091f2b61c04ba4ecad6d641f0 Mon Sep 17 00:00:00 2001 From: hamster1963 <1410514192@qq.com> Date: Tue, 18 Feb 2025 18:04:19 +0800 Subject: [PATCH] feat: add AnimatedCount to server overview metrics --- .../main/ServerOverviewClient.tsx | 19 +++++++++++++------ 1 file changed, 13 insertions(+), 6 deletions(-) diff --git a/app/(main)/ClientComponents/main/ServerOverviewClient.tsx b/app/(main)/ClientComponents/main/ServerOverviewClient.tsx index 0d82027..46c076f 100644 --- a/app/(main)/ClientComponents/main/ServerOverviewClient.tsx +++ b/app/(main)/ClientComponents/main/ServerOverviewClient.tsx @@ -3,6 +3,7 @@ import { useFilter } from "@/app/context/network-filter-context" import { useServerData } from "@/app/context/server-data-context" import { useStatus } from "@/app/context/status-context" +import AnimateCountClient from "@/components/AnimatedCount" import { Loader } from "@/components/loading/Loader" import { Card, CardContent } from "@/components/ui/card" import getEnv from "@/lib/env-entry" @@ -44,12 +45,14 @@ export default function ServerOverviewClient() {

{t("p_816-881_Totalservers")}

-
+
{data?.result ? ( -
{data?.result.length}
+
+ +
) : (
@@ -74,13 +77,15 @@ export default function ServerOverviewClient() {

{t("p_1610-1676_Onlineservers")}

-
+
{data?.result ? ( -
{data?.live_servers}
+
+ +
) : (
@@ -105,13 +110,15 @@ export default function ServerOverviewClient() {

{t("p_2532-2599_Offlineservers")}

-
+
{data?.result ? ( -
{data?.offline_servers}
+
+ +
) : (